ホームページ >バックエンド開発 >Golang >インストールされている Go パッケージのリストを取得するにはどうすればよいですか?

インストールされている Go パッケージのリストを取得するにはどうすればよいですか?

Patricia Arquette
Patricia Arquetteオリジナル
2024-10-30 09:26:03963ブラウズ

How Do I Get a List of Installed Go Packages?

Go でインストールされているパッケージのリストを確認する

インストールされている Go パッケージの包括的なリストを取得することは、パッケージを再インストールする場合など、さまざまなシナリオで重要です。別のマシン。この記事では、goinstall を使用してインストール済みパッケージを一覧表示するという問題について説明します。この方法は、現在の Go インストールには適用できなくなりました。

Go バージョン 1.0 以降の更新された方法

へインストールされている Go パッケージの完全なリストを取得するには、次のコマンドを使用します。

go list ...

3 つのリテラル ピリオド「...」は、システム上のすべてのパッケージに一致するワイルドカードを表します。

出力例:

github.com/fvbommel/sortorder
github.com/go-delve/delve
github.com/golang/glog
github.com/google/pprof
github.com/ianlancetaylor/demangle
github.com/mattn/go-sqlite3
github.com/michielheld/godocrunner
github.com/rogpeppe/godef
github.com/rogpeppe/goinstall
github.com/uber-go/zap

追加のコマンド オプション

go list コマンドには広範なオプションが用意されています。詳細については、 go list -h を参照してください。

代替リソース

go list コマンドの多用途性の詳細については、Dave Cheney のブログ記事を参照してください: [goリスト、あなたのスイスアーミーナイフ](https://dave.cheney.net/2015/09/01/go-list-your-swiss-army-knife).

以上がインストールされている Go パッケージのリストを取得する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。